Explore old temple ruins in the critter cave in search for lost treasure!
Hello everyone

I just put my demo of critter cave online.
This was just some fooling around with the 3d glitch tool and some other stuff that I wanted to try out and it evolved over time into a short level.

I feel it's pretty fun and starts off with some nice puzzle gameplay and evolves into a climbing / platforming / exploring gameplay near the second half.

I'd love to hear some opinions on how this turned out because I'm planning to use some skills I learned here in my upcoming level based around saw (which is going to be awesome).

Features:

+ 3d background while climbing / hanging on a rope to give a sense of scale and depth
+ rope grabbing feature
+ nice puzzle in the beginning
+ some platforming gameplay involving rotating wheels
+3d foreground graphics to show off an old bridge near the end


not all sound effects have been added so far, but I 'm planning to do this in the near future together with adding a giant boss battle involving a big squid (if the level scores decent enough).
